MEXICO — The Mexico Recreation Department has been hit once again by thieves.

Chief James Theriault said Recreation Department Director Greg Arsenault reported Wednesday that someone broke into the storage shed at the Mexico Recreation Park located on Route 17 and took a weed-whacker valued at $350, a booster cable and a tractor battery, both valued at $70. The door was broken to gain entrance.

He said the burglary and theft took place sometime within the past two weeks.

The town-run recreation program has been hit several times during the past year. Last fall, in separate incidents, someone made off with an industrial-type vacuum cleaner, a weed-whacker, and a gas can from the recreation building located in town. None of those items were ever recovered.

Police have no leads on the latest thefts.
